Moth Extermination Questions
What are common signs of moth infestations? Visible holes in fabrics, shed skins, and the presence of larvae or adult moths are typical indicators of an infestation.
Which areas are most vulnerable to moths? Closets, storage boxes, and areas with natural fibers like wool, silk, or cotton are especially susceptible.
How can property owners prevent moth problems? Regular cleaning, storing clothing in airtight containers, and inspecting stored items help reduce the risk of moth infestations.
What types of projects typically require moth extermination services? Infestations in closets, attics, storage units, or commercial spaces with fabric or natural fiber goods often need professional treatment.
